About this clipart
The image features a bold blue circle on a black background, with two opposing curved arrows along the upper arc indicating a continuous cycle, and a straight diagonal arrow crossing the circle to represent linear movement or transformation. All arrows are bidirectional, suggesting reversible or iterative processes. This minimalist schematic is commonly used in engineering, business process modeling, and educational contexts to depict dynamic systems.
